Criptomoedas

O que é o Bitcoin Core: como o software alimenta o Bitcoin e por que está gerando debate recentemente

Nova política de retransmissão do Bitcoin Core gera debates na comunidade cripto ao permitir mais dados nas transações através do OP_RETURN

CoinEx
Software Bitcoin Core validando transações em um computador, mostrando códigos e dados da blockchain em uma tela preta | Crédito: Divulgação

O Bitcoin Core enfrenta críticas após mudanças na política de retransmissão. Por isso, é importante entender como esse software mantém o Bitcoin funcionando e por que sua última atualização gerou polêmica na comunidade.

Resumo

  • Em primeiro lugar, o Bitcoin Core é o software de código aberto que executa a rede Bitcoin, validando transações e blocos.
  • Além disso, o projeto é mantido por uma comunidade global de desenvolvedores por meio de um modelo de governança descentralizado baseado em consenso.
  • Dessa forma, o Bitcoin Core sustenta o Bitcoin ao verificar transações. No entanto, uma nova regra permitindo mais dados gerou reações mistas de desenvolvedores e usuários.
  • Por fim, o Bitcoin Core garante justiça e segurança ao Bitcoin. Uma atualização recente reacendeu o debate sobre como equilibrar inovação e descentralização.

Em outras palavras, o Bitcoin é um livro-razão digital descentralizado que registra transações sem uma autoridade central. Assim sendo, o Bitcoin Core, o software que alimenta essa rede, garante que essas transações sejam seguras e descentralizadas. Sem dúvida, ele é a espinha dorsal do sistema, evitando fraudes.

Em virtude de debates recentes sobre mudanças na política de retransmissão do Bitcoin Core, surgiram questões sobre o futuro da rede.

O que é o Bitcoin Core?

De acordo com o Bitcoin.org (2025), o Bitcoin Core é o software original que executa a rede Bitcoin. Em outras palavras, pense nele como o livro de regras e o árbitro ao mesmo tempo. É um projeto de código aberto, ou seja, qualquer pessoa pode ver o código, sugerir mudanças ou usá-lo para executar seu próprio nó Bitcoin.

A princípio, um “nó completo” é um computador que executa o Bitcoin Core e verifica todas as transações e blocos, garantindo que sigam as regras da rede. Esse processo de validação é essencial — ele evita transações falsas e mantém a integridade do sistema.

Além disso, o Bitcoin Core também oferece uma carteira para armazenar e enviar Bitcoin, permite que usuários transmitam transações para a rede, e pode ser usado com a Lightning Network para pagamentos mais rápidos e baratos.

Por certo, executar um nó completo não é só para especialistas — qualquer pessoa pode ajudar a manter o Bitcoin descentralizado. Como resultado, quanto mais nós existem, mais difícil é para um grupo controlar a rede.

Em suma, Satoshi Nakamoto lançou o Bitcoin Core em 2009. Desde então, evoluiu com contribuições da comunidade e se tornou o software central do Bitcoin. Em conclusão, ele é mais que código: é a base de um sistema criado para ser livre de controle centralizado.

Como o Bitcoin Core alimenta a rede?

O Bitcoin Core funciona como a cola que mantém a rede unida.

Veja como:

  • Validação de transações e propagação de blocos: uma vez que você envia Bitcoin, sua transação é transmitida à rede. Nós completos com Bitcoin Core verificam se é válida — o remetente tem saldo suficiente? A transação está formatada corretamente? Se estiver tudo certo, o nó retransmite para outros.
  • Manutenção das regras de consenso: acima de tudo, o Bitcoin Core aplica as regras da rede — como o limite de 21 milhões de bitcoins — e garante que todos os nós vejam a mesma versão do blockchain. Por isso, tentativas de burlar o sistema, como gastar o mesmo Bitcoin duas vezes, são automaticamente rejeitadas.
  • Prevenção de gastos duplos: da mesma forma, ao validar transações, o Bitcoin Core garante que ninguém possa gastar o mesmo BTC duas vezes. É como se um caixa verificasse se o dinheiro não é falso antes de aceitar.
  • Descentralização e segurança: em virtude de cada nó completo fortalecer a natureza descentralizada do Bitcoin, se um nó for atacado, milhares de outros continuam mantendo a rede. Dessa maneira, rodar o Bitcoin Core em seu computador é ajudar a verificar transações de forma independente — tornando o sistema mais resiliente.

Governança e fesenvolvimento do Bitcoin Core

A comunidade global mantém o Bitcoin Core, sem controle de nenhuma empresa ou pessoa. Desenvolvedores voluntários ativamente corrigem bugs, adicionam recursos e propõem mudanças através das BIPs (Propostas de Melhoria do Bitcoin).

A comunidade toma as decisões por consenso. Os desenvolvedores discutem as ideias no GitHub e fóruns como o BitcoinTalk. A maioria dos nós precisa adotar o software atualizado para implementar uma mudança. Esse modelo deliberativo lento protege contra alterações precipitadas — funcionando como uma assembleia comunitária onde todos participam ativamente.

A transparência é essencial. Todas as mudanças de código são públicas, e qualquer pessoa pode revisar ou comentar. Como resultado, isso constrói confiança e evita alterações maliciosas. A colaboração comunitária mantém o Bitcoin Core fiel à proposta original: uma moeda descentralizada e segura.

Controvérsia recente: mudanças na política de retransmissão do Bitcoin Core

Em 7 de junho de 2025, os desenvolvedores do Bitcoin Core anunciaram uma nova política de retransmissão, que gerou reações intensas. A política dá mais liberdade aos nós para escolher quais transações retransmitir.

Uma mudança significativa foi o aumento do limite de bytes no campo OP_RETURN de 80 para 160, apoiando projetos como o BitVM (que busca trazer contratos inteligentes ao Bitcoin). Por exemplo, o OP_RETURN permite anexar pequenos dados às transações, como notas ou registros digitais.

No entanto, esse limite já foi imposto para evitar abusos, mas uma atualização de rede em 8 de maio de 2025 removeu algumas restrições e dobrou o tamanho do OP_RETURN. A versão Core 30, prevista para outubro, aumentará esse limite para até 4 MB.

Por um lado, críticos temem que transações com muitos dados aumentem taxas e causem lentidão. Além disso, há receio de centralização se grandes nós ou mineradoras priorizarem certos tipos de transação. Por outro lado, defensores veem isso como uma evolução rumo a uma rede mais flexível e resistente à censura.

Conclusão

O Bitcoin Core é o alicerce da segurança e descentralização da rede Bitcoin. Em suma, seu modelo aberto e comunitário promove confiança. O debate atual sobre OP_RETURN e a política de retransmissão mostra como a comunidade busca equilibrar inovação com eficiência.

À medida que o Bitcoin evolui, seu futuro depende de quem participa ativamente. Assim sendo, você pode se envolver baixando o Bitcoin Core, rodando um nó ou participando de discussões no GitHub e fóruns. Seja com preocupações sobre dados ou entusiasmo por novas possibilidades, sua voz é parte essencial para garantir que o Bitcoin continue resiliente, descentralizado e inovador.

Referência

Bitcoin.org. (2025). Bitcoin Core. Disponível em: https://bitcoin.org/en/bitcoin-core/